Output 2029e91be437c631293172770fd53944d502c0357223c64f3e4a9fba8239e078:3

value
484860
script pubkey
OP_0 OP_PUSHBYTES_20 e83399b9b35a32fdf5927e2695ecc7702477f402
address
tb1qaqeenwdntge0mavj0cnftmx8wqj80aqz6wedp6
transaction
2029e91be437c631293172770fd53944d502c0357223c64f3e4a9fba8239e078
confirmations
35772
spent
true